Understanding the Role of Bulk Humidity Sensors
A bulk humidity sensor is designed to measure the moisture levels in various environments, providing essential data to farmers about soil and atmospheric conditions. This technology is instrumental in ensuring crops receive the optimal amount of water, which can lead to healthier plants and increased yields.
1. Enhanced Crop Management
One of the most significant benefits of using bulk humidity sensors is their ability to enhance crop management. By providing real-time data on moisture levels, farmers can make informed decisions about irrigation schedules. For instance, if a sensor indicates high humidity levels in the soil, the farmer can delay watering, conserving water and preventing over-irrigation—an issue that could lead to plant stress or root rot.
2. Cost Savings on Water and Resources
Utilizing bulk humidity sensors can translate to substantial cost savings. Traditional farming methods often rely on fixed irrigation schedules, which can lead to wasteful water usage. With accurate humidity data, farmers can adopt a more efficient approach, applying water only when necessary, ultimately reducing water costs and promoting sustainable practices.
3. Optimizing Fertilizer Use
Bulk humidity sensors do not only benefit irrigation management; they also play a crucial role in fertilizer application. Soil moisture levels can impact the availability of nutrients in the soil. By leveraging humidity data, farmers can time their fertilizer applications to coincide with optimal soil conditions, which maximizes nutrient absorption and minimizes waste.

4. Increased Crop Yields
Consistent monitoring of humidity levels can significantly impact crop yields. As farmers gain better insights into the moisture needs of their crops, they can adjust their farming practices accordingly, leading to healthier and more robust crops. The direct correlation between precise moisture management and improved crop yields makes bulk humidity sensors an invaluable tool for modern agriculture.
5. Reducing Environmental Impact
With climate change and environmental sustainability being critical issues, using bulk humidity sensors allows for a more environmentally responsible approach to farming. By optimizing water usage and minimizing runoff from over-fertilized fields, farmers can reduce their ecological footprint and promote soil health.
